Hi! i have a question about the new sf 1.3 getMailer method ... i guess it would be better to be inserted into sfComponents as sfActions extends sfComponents.
I do think that is not in the right place, because i have met a problem. 1) had several emails to send form different actions of my project, so i have decided to move all the mail actions to a new module called Emails. 2) I have created a new "component" and i have inserted there the code that i had for emails, to be much easier to access from other modules by using $this->getComponent() 3) After a short while i have noticed that i need to pass a sfActions instance to the component just to be sure that i have access to the getMailer method ... maybe i have done something wrong by moving all the email actions into the component, but it was the single way that i have seen at the moment not to Repeat myself ...
